How it Works

Windows Defender is more than just an antivirus software; it is a comprehensive security system designed to protect your computer from various threats. Its baseline functionality includes scanning your system for malware, ransomware, and other types of viruses. It also provides security checks for any unauthorized or suspicious network activity, safeguarding against all types of malware. This program can also be centrally managed in larger networks, depending on configuration, making it a solid solution for business security.

Common Questions

Does Windows Defender slow down my system?

No, Windows Defender is designed to operate discreetly in the background. User interaction is minimal, and most scanning and protective operations occur during optimized system times, not affecting daily activities unless specific malfunctions detected.

Can I manually configure scanner settings?

Yes, user configurability allows for tailored scanning schedules and resource management.

How often does it update?

Windows Defender updates automatically via Windows Update, ensuring users always have the latest protection against emerging threats.
